Really, I'd say you'd have a pretty tough time changing you're own firewall, unless you're a very accomplished welder....
In addition to all the normal costs, consider that you need the JDM window switches, dash, power steering rack, resivoir mounts, battery mount, not to mention all the hard line that you need to change that will no longer fit. Hell, but the time you get done converting your car, you'll be more than 3/4 the cost of just buying a right hand drive ITR.
